Brow lift

How it works: By far the most gruesome-sounding of all cosmetic procedures, this involves making four incisions above the hairline and under the scalp. A small telescope (endoscope) is used to work under the surface of the skin, lifting it off the bone. Skin is then pulled upwards and fixed into place with small screws in the skull for two to three weeks. They are removed once the skin has reset itself in its new position. Risks are minimal, and scarring is usually obscured by hair.
